Exegesis
The causal conjunction ki yesh {כִּי־יֵשׁ | kî yēš} ‘for there is’ links to the noun tikvah {תִּקְוָ֑ה | tiqvāh} ‘hope’, forming a conditional temporal clause.
In context — Proverbs 19:18
Discipline your son while there is hope, and do not let your soul desire his death.
